How Common Is The Last Name Kordoski?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 2,121,169th most widely held family name at a global level. It is borne by approximately 1 in 92,247,417 people. The surname Kordoski is primarily found in Europe, where 65 percent of Kordoski live; 65 percent live in Southeastern Europe and 65 percent live in South Slavic Europe.

The surname is most common in North Macedonia, where it is borne by 51 people, or 1 in 41,205. In North Macedonia it is most numerous in: Southwestern, where 98 percent live and Skopje, where 2 percent live. Besides North Macedonia it is found in 2 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 28 percent live and Canada, where 8 percent live.
